云原生技术的优势以及技术的挑战是什么

2020-11-18 人浏览 点击收藏: 分享至:

  也许云原生技术最大的优势是快速部署。还是那个天气应用,让我们假设一个国家的特定地区需要空气质量指数数据,要求快速实现功能。
  
  如果空气质量指数数据依赖于原系统运行,部署该功能可能需要数月的计划和数十次对话,以确保过程中没有其他中断。不过,有了独立的服务,一个由两名工程师组成的团队就有可能在几天内构建并部署该功能。
  
  更容易自动化是另一个好处。CNCF有很多成熟的技术和正在孵化中的技术,比如GitOps和Hashicorp的Vault,支持安全的构建部署脚本,这大大加快了部署速度。现在,每个不同的部署环境都不需要定制脚本。


云原生



  
  然后是可伸缩性和可靠性。有了基于云的软件,开发团队就可以随意地添加功能、规划容量、存储等等,而不需要担心物理硬件。这是因为在分布式系统中运行的容器化软件不需要了解系统的其他部分就可以工作。工程师和运维人员也不用担心影响系统地其他部分或有数据丢失的风险。
  
  最后,还有成本节约。简单的可伸缩性使得优化更容易。特别是对于托管的云服务,云服务提供商或中介帮助公司分配计算负载,公司只支付他们所需的资源,而不是让固定数量的服务器一直运行。
  
  云原生技术的挑战是什么
  
  随着新技术的出现,新的挑战也随之而来。在云原生的世界里,可观测性,或者说是看到计算机系统内部发生了什么的能力,是一个很大的挑战。
  
  “人们正试图弄清楚如何确保他们拥有和以前一样的信息和能力来理解他们自己的系统,”Sharma说,“复杂、松散耦合的分布式系统的一个缺点是,随着公司规模的扩大,一个人很难完全理解它。”
  
  换句话说,所有这些容器都运行在不同的服务器上。容器可以在不同的服务器之间移动,但谁在跟踪呢?如果系统的可观测性很差,就很难理解在提交请求之后会发生什么。
  
  责任编辑:浪潮云云原生信息,原创不易,转载是必须以链接形式注明作者和原始出处及本声明。

查看全部
相关文章推荐相关文章推荐
原生技术优势以及技术挑战是什么 原生代表性技术有哪些 原生定义以及业务价值 原生应用价值是什么 原生已成为新技术浪潮 原生基于特点在那个阶段 计算机技术概念以及关键 计算与大数据技术特点是什么 计算技术盘点 政府行业成原生玩家必争之地,制胜或在“赛道”之外
热门解决方案热门解决方案
园区安全生产在线监测解决方案_环保在线监测设备 电子采购平台解决方案_采购与供应管理平台_电子采购系统搭建 金融行业测试云解决方案_银行业测试云平台 浪潮制药行业解决方案_医疗行业解决方案 工业互联网仿真计算平台解决方案_仿真云系统 转动设备(采煤、化工行业)健康智能监测解决方案_转动设备在线监测预警系统 远程诊疗浪潮云解决方案_智慧医疗一体化解决方案 金融智能机器人解决方案_智能客服解决方案 锅炉安全运行智能预警系统解决方案_锅炉安全监控系统_锅炉自动化控制系统 在线教育解决方案_教育行业解决方案_远程教育平台搭建
热门产品推荐热门产品推荐
热门标签热门标签